How Cardiac Catheterisation Lab Nurses Can Convert PDF Clinical Guidelines and Research to EPUB for Mobile Reading (2026)

Cardiac catheterisation lab nurses work at the intersection of acute cardiology and complex interventional procedures — preparing patients for diagnostic coronary angiography, perc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I), trans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R/TAVI), mitral clip procedures, and structural heart interventions. The documentary load includes ESC guidelines on coronary artery disease and valvular heart disease, BCIS/BCS catheter laboratory standards, NICE TA566 (TAVI), NHS England specialised cardiac services specifications, radiation protection guidance, and journals including EuroIntervention, the Journal of the American College of Cardiology, and Heart. Converting these PDFs to EPUB makes them searchable and mobile-accessible for pre-list preparation, patient consent support, and CPD.

Key PDF Sources for Cardiac Catheterisation Lab Nurses

DocumentIssuing BodyWhy It Matters
ESC Guidelines on Coronary Artery Disease (2023)European Society of CardiologyEvidence base for PCI indications, antiplatelet therapy, and outcomes
ESC Guidelines on Valvular Heart Disease (2021)European Society of CardiologyTAVI, MitraClip, and surgical valve replacement decision thresholds
BCIS/BCS Catheter Laboratory StandardsBritish Cardiovascular Intervention Society / BCSUK quality and safety standards for cardiac catheterisation units
NICE TA566 — TAVI for aortic stenosisNICENHS-funded TAVI eligibility and procedural standards
PHE Radiation Protection GuidancePublic Health England / UKHSADose reference levels, staff protection, and pregnant worker restrictions
